What Annoys Customers on Your Website

Offline businesses take a lot of efforts to make their offices or stores comfortable and pleasant for their customers. Online businesses must take care of their websites. Many businessmen and women think that creating a website is easy. But are they aware of small things that can drive their customers crazy? So how do you avoid annoying your website visitors by creating a user-friendly website?

First of all a user-friendly website must provide enough information about products, so the customers were able to make a decision right away. If they do not find required information, they will switch to your competitors, where they can find what they need. It does not imply that you need to add as much information as possible. Every product has a minimum required description that satisfies most of the consumers. Make sure that you cover this minimum. Some extra information may come useful and attract customers to your website. Too much information can cause unnecessary doubts, that is why we do not recommend to use excessive descriptions. 

Make sure that your language is understandable to your customers. You can be original in anything that does not affect usability and comprehension. Know who your customers are and what their education is. Test your texts on the difficulty testers.

After you polish up the website content, there still can be customers who have questions and concerns that are not covered your website. People always want to know that you are a real business with real people. This is why your contact information is another thing to consider. Your contact information should be easy to find, and your phones and chat must be picked up and emails replied. Nothing annoys customers more than a failed contact.
